A curated selection of safe, accessible, and welcoming global destinations ideal for individuals embarking on their first solo adventure. These locations offer excellent infrastructure, low crime rates, and abundant opportunities for social interaction, ensuring a secure and enriching travel experience for beginners navigating the world on their own.

One of the safest cities in the world, Singapore offers exceptional public transport, cleanliness, and a straightforward English-speaking environment. Its compact size and efficient metro system make it easy for first-timers to navigate without language barriers or logistical stress.
Known for its low crime rate and high English proficiency, Iceland provides a secure backdrop for solo exploration. The Golden Circle route offers stunning natural wonders that are easily accessible via organized tours or rental cars, minimizing travel anxiety.
Japan combines cutting-edge urban infrastructure with deep cultural traditions, offering unparalleled safety and politeness for solo travelers. The extensive rail network and English signage in major hubs like Tokyo and Kyoto simplify navigation for those traveling alone.
Often cited as the best European destination for solo travelers, Portugal is affordable, warm, and incredibly friendly. Cities like Lisbon and Porto offer vibrant social scenes, affordable accommodation, and a relaxed atmosphere that encourages meeting new people.
Canada provides vast natural beauty and a reputation for safety and multicultural inclusivity. Vancouver serves as a gentle entry point with mild weather, while nearby Banff National Park offers structured hiking tours perfect for meeting other solo adventurers.

Switzerland boasts one of the world's most reliable and scenic public transport systems, making train travel effortless and secure. Cities like Zurich and hubs like Interlaken offer clean accommodations and stunning landscapes that are easy to explore independently.
Major Australian cities are safe, multicultural, and have excellent English-speaking environments. Melbourne is known for its cafe culture and walkable neighborhoods, while Sydney offers iconic sights that are easily reachable via public transit, perfect for independent exploration.
The Irish are famously welcoming, making social isolation rare even when traveling alone. Dublin offers a lively pub culture for meeting locals, while the Dingle Peninsula provides scenic drives and small-town charm that feel safe and welcoming for beginners.
A leader in eco-tourism, Costa Rica is relatively safe and accustomed to solo Western travelers. Organized day trips to volcanoes and rainforests provide structured environments to explore nature and meet other tourists, reducing the need for complex solo logistics.
Norway combines high safety standards with breathtaking natural beauty. Oslo is a walkable, low-crime city with great museums, while guided fjord tours offer a safe and stunning way to experience the landscape without needing complex hiking skills.
Copenhagen is consistently ranked as one of the happiest and safest cities globally. Its extensive bicycle infrastructure and compact center make it easy to explore on two wheels, while the hygge culture encourages social connection in cafes and parks.
Seoul is incredibly safe, with low violent crime rates and efficient public transport. The city offers a unique blend of modern technology and ancient temples, with many signs available in English, making navigation straightforward for international solo visitors.
Greece is welcoming to solo travelers, particularly in Athens where the city center is safe and walkable. Island hopping to places like Crete offers a mix of historical exploration and beach relaxation, with many tour options available for independent groups.
Often overlooked, Uruguay is the safest country in South America with a European feel. Montevideo is compact and safe, offering a relaxed pace, affordable costs, and a friendly culture that makes solo travel less intimidating for first-timers.
Croatia combines stunning coastal scenery with central European safety standards. Dubrovnik is manageable for walking, while Zagreb offers a vibrant urban experience. The well-developed tourist infrastructure ensures that solo travelers can easily find safe transport and lodging.
Slovenia is small, green, and exceptionally safe, with Ljubljana being one of Europe's most livable cities. The capital is walkable and friendly, while nearby lakes and mountains offer easy day trips that can be joined via organized tours for added security.
While bustling, Vietnam has become increasingly accessible to solo travelers with a well-established backpacker trail. Hostels in Hanoi and Ho Chi Minh City provide social hubs, and group tours for motorbike or bus journeys are widely available for safety and companionship.
Tallinn is a hidden gem with a medieval old town that is safe, compact, and highly digitized. With widespread English proficiency and a low crime rate, it offers a stress-free introduction to European travel with a unique blend of old and new.
